According to an article appeared on ValveWorld, Romanian o&g firm OMV Petrom completed theconstruction works at two new gas treatment plants. The two projects, which required investment of over €130 million starting in 2013, will ensure gas deliveries into the national transport system at pressures of up to 40 bar. The new facilities treat approximately 7.5% of OMV Petrom’s gas production in Romania. If used for heating only, the annual gas production processed at Burcioaia and Mădulari could cover the needs of over 330,000 households.
